CLERIC (DEAD TO A DYING WORLD, ex-KILL THE CLIENT) Enters The "Maw Of Absolution" With Brutal New Death Metal Single

Cleric 2019

Texas supergroup Cleric has returned from the abyss to double down on their take of Swedish death metal worship. The band has announced a new album called Serpent Psalms, due out Oct. 25 via Redefining Darkness Records and Raw Skullz Records.

Featuring current and former members of Dead to a Dying World, Kill The Client, Runes of the Evening and Tyrannosorceress, the quartet's new single, "Maw of Absolution," is a pretty good introduction to the band in case you missed them the first time around.

If you like your death metal to sound old-school like Asphyx, Bolt Thrower, Dismember or Bloodbath, check this shit out:
